Understanding Influencer Marketing

Influencer marketing is a type of marketing that involves collaborating with popular social media users to promote a brand's products or services. Defining influencer marketing is important because it has become a popular marketing strategy in recent years. According to Sprout Social, influencer marketing has evolved significantly over the past decade, expanding beyond celebrities to include social media influencers who foster authentic connections and influence purchase decisions and brand reputation.

Defining Influencer Marketing

Influencer marketing is a collaboration between brands and social media influencers to promote products or services. Social media influencers have a large following on social media platforms such as Instagram, YouTube, and TikTok. These influencers have built a loyal following by sharing content that resonates with their audience. Brands can leverage the influencer's following to reach a wider audience and promote their products or services.

The Importance of Trust and Authenticity

Unlike traditional marketing strategies, influencer marketing requires a high level of trust between the brand and the influencer. According to Forbes, influencer marketing is effective because it is based on trust and authenticity. Influencers are often required to sign lawful contracts, but the care they take to maintain their authenticity is what makes them effective.

Types of Influencers: From Nano to Mega

There are different types of influencers, ranging from nano-influencers to mega-influencers. Nano-influencers have a smaller following, usually between 1,000 to 10,000 followers, while mega-influencers have a larger following, usually over 1 million followers. According to Influencer Marketing Hub, micro-influencers and macro-influencers fall in between these two categories. Micro-influencers have between 10,000 to 100,000 followers, while macro-influencers have between 100,000 to 1 million followers.

Setting Clear Marketing Goals

Before you start working with influencers, it's important to set clear marketing goals. This will help you identify the metrics you need to track to measure the success of your campaign. Your goals should be specific, measurable, achievable, relevant, and time-bound. For example, you might want to increase brand awareness, drive sales, or improve engagement on social media.

Identifying the Right Influencers for Your Brand

To ensure that your influencer marketing campaign is successful, you need to identify the right influencers for your brand. This means doing your research to find influencers who are a good fit for your niche and target audience. You can use tools like FollowerWonk, BuzzSumo, and Klear to identify influencers based on their audience demographics, engagement rates, and content themes.

Crafting a Compelling Influencer Brief

Once you've identified the right influencers for your brand, you need to craft a compelling influencer brief that clearly outlines your expectations and requirements. This should include information about your brand, the campaign objectives, the content format, and any specific guidelines or requirements. By providing influencers with a clear brief, you can ensure that they create content that aligns with your brand values and resonates with your target audience.

Avoiding Common Pitfalls

There are several common mistakes that businesses make when launching influencer marketing campaigns. These include working with the wrong influencers, failing to establish clear goals, and neglecting to measure ROI. To avoid these pitfalls, it is important to carefully vet potential influencers, establish clear KPIs, and track ROI throughout the campaign. By doing so, you can ensure that your influencer marketing campaigns are effective and provide a positive ROI.
